Just like Raskolnikov debated whether or not to rob and kill in “Crime and Punishment,” we’d recommend you stop and think about drinking Crime and Punishment from Stone Brewing Co. next time you see them at the bar. The two new beers from the San Diego brewery are not for the timid. Crime is a version of Lucky Bastard – which is a blend of Arrogant Bastard, Oaked Arrogant Bastard and Double Bastard – that’s brewed with an absurd amount of peppers, and Punishment is the same except with just Double Bastard Ale as the base. We’d say the 9.6% ABV and 12% ABV respectively are fairly strong, but that really won’t matter when you’re chasing each sip with a gallon of milk.
